Output 24b1372ade6390cf4e40f47f03417d0431fddccc4e248f4bb4b698de8fce72dc:120

value
90271
script pubkey
OP_0 OP_PUSHBYTES_20 174b85ab61b54652ad28e076cd7a1df9a93f9783
address
bc1qza9ct2mpk4r99tfgupmv67salx5nl9uraw07c2
transaction
24b1372ade6390cf4e40f47f03417d0431fddccc4e248f4bb4b698de8fce72dc
confirmations
26092
spent
true